Four Vehicles – Three Separate Collisions In Hamilton Township

In Police Blotter

Four vehicles were involved in three separate collisions on County Road 2, west of Theatre Road in Hamilton Township on Friday, June 28, 2019.

Northumberland OPP said preliminary investigation reveals one car heading westbound rolled into the ditch landing on its roof at approximately 8:25 p.m.

A westbound pickup truck slowed and was rear-ended by another vehicle.

Further down the road another westbound vehicle went in the ditch.

It’s believed no one was seriously involved in the collisions.

Emergency services including Northumberland OPP, Northumberland County Paramedics, Cobourg Fire Department and Hamilton Township Fire Department attended the scene.
